JimmyRigged New Member Aug 27, So I ditched all the predators and went for some gx's and I was wondering if the stage 1 hop up kit 18lbs valve springs, air filter and adapter, smaller fan, header, jet, and gaskets and governor removed would be a decent up grade and I need anything else or if anything else is suggested I get?
Also I have 11" slicks with a 72 oth sprocket and 12 tooth clutch so I have great lower end but I want more top speed that's the reason for the mods please give me your inputs. I left out that it also comes with 8 degree timing key and choke holder. Last edited: Aug 27, Newoldstock New Member Aug 27, No Jimmy. Its not much of a kit. Its just a very thin handfull of parts. First thing you need to do before you buy is a billet flywheel, billet rod and a good Honda piston.
Then the engine will be reliable and strong, add a filter jet kit and header Then add the springs. Knowing from the beginning that the valve train in this style engine is there weakest point, I changed over to roller rocker arms.
I run Gage 1. A combination of aluminum "Gage" rockers and cast aluminum valve "Aussie Speed" cover deaden the sound. I do run tighter tolerances valve settings because of this,. With added air shrouds on the head it cools better so less expansion. Amazing what a piece of tin and a bolt can do.
All said, mine runs very very quiet compared to the first time it ran. Further notes on valve train. Being Ray I changed to the then sold by VC billet stud mounted 1.
That really quieted the ting ting valve train noise. VC then posted that the silver hd springs had issues with coil bind on anything but stock lift cams and recommended going to the gold comp cams version.
But I continued to run the silver spring set up for about hours until my tear down. This was to change to the torque cam and replace the cast rod with the VC produced billet rod. The only issue I seen was the guide plate for the push rods was sort of ovaled out from wear. Sho was doing his lifan near this time so I advised him to look at his guide plate.
It showed a similar issue. We both switched to the NRracing shaft mounted roller rockers and torque cams at this time. The lifters are still in the engine since they showed no wear on the tear down.
